Ingredients for Red Velvet Thumbprint Cookies

To whip up these delightful red velvet thumbprint cookies, you’ll need some simple yet essential ingredients. Here’s what you’ll gather: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tablespoon red food coloring
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up cream cheese frosting

Make sure to have everything prepped and ready, because once you start mixing, you won’t want to stop! The combination of flavors will have your kitchen smelling heavenly in no time.

How to Prepare Red Velvet Thumbprint Cookies

Alright, let’s dive into making these gorgeous red velvet thumbprint cookies! First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is crucial because you want your cookies to bake evenly and come out just right. While that’s heating up, grab two mixing bowls. In one,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. This ensures your dry ingredients are well combined and ready to mingle later.

In the second bowl, cream the softened butter and sugar together until it’s light and fluffy—this usually takes about 2-3 minutes. Then, add in the egg, red food coloring, and vanilla extract, mixing until everything is beautifully blended. Now comes the fun part: gradually add your dry mixture to the wet ingredients. Mix just until you see no more flour, but don’t overdo it! Once your dough is ready, roll it into balls and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Now, here’s where the magic happens! With your thumb, press down gently in the center of each dough ball to create a little well. This is where the cream cheese frosting will sit, so make sure it’s nice and deep! Fill each thumbprint with a dollop of that creamy frosting—don’t be shy, it’s the best part! Bake your cookies for 10-12 minutes. The edges will be firm, but the centers should still be soft. Let them c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. And voila, you’re ready to enjoy these scrumptious treats!

Tips for Success with Red Velvet Thumbprint Cookies

To make sure your red velvet thumbprint cookies turn out absolutely perfect, here are some handy tips! First, I highly recommend chilling your dough for about 30 minutes before rolling it into balls. This makes the dough easier to handle and helps the cookies maintain their shape while baking. Also, when you’re creating the thumbprint, don’t press too hard; just enough to make a nice indentation. And remember, every oven is different, so keep an eye on them as they bake. If they start to look too golden, pull them out! These little adjustments will elevate your cookies to the next level!

FAQ About Red Velvet Thumbprint Cookies

You might have a few questions about making these delightful red velvet thumbprint cookies, and I’m here to help! Here are some of the most common queries I get:

Can I use a different frosting?
Absolutely! While cream cheese frosting is divine, feel free to experiment with chocolate ganache or vanilla buttercream for a twist.

What if I don’t have red food coloring?
If you’re in a pinch, you can use beet juice for a natural alternative, though it might alter the taste slightly.

Can I make the dough ahead of time?
Yes! Just chill the dough for up to 24 hours in the fridge. This can actually enhance the flavor!

Why did my cookies spread too much?
If your butter was too warm or you didn’t chill the dough, that might be why. Keeping them cool helps maintain their shape.

How do I store leftovers?
Store your c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. They’ll stay delicious and soft!

Storage & Reheating Instructions for Red Velvet Thumbprint Cookies

To keep your red velvet thumbprint cookies fresh and delicious,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ay soft and tasty for up to a week—if they last that long! If you want to indulge later, you can also freeze them. Just make sure they’re completely cool, then layer them between parchment paper in a freezer-safe container. They’ll hold up nicely for about 2 months.

When you’re ready to enjoy a cookie, no need for fancy reheating—just let them sit at room temperature for a few minutes. They’ll be just as delightful as the day you baked them!
